What Does “Longest Flight in the World” Even Mean?
| Type of Flight | Definition |
|---|---|
| Non-Stop Flight | No stops from take-off to landing. |
| Direct Flight (with a stop where you don’t deplane) | Stops only to refuel or change crew, but passengers stay on board. |
| By Distance | Based on how many kilometers/ miles the plane flies over the globe. |
| By Duration | Based on how many hours you spend in the air. |

Current Longest Non-Stop Commercial Flight (2025)
Singapore Airlines — New York (JFK) ↔ Singapore (SIN)
This is currently the longest non-stop scheduled passenger flight in the world, and it’s absolutely legendary.
| Route | Airline | Distance | Approx. Flight Time | Aircraft |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| New York (JFK) → Singapore (SIN) | Singapore Airlines | ~15,349 km | ~18 hr 40 min | Airbus A350-900ULR |
| Singapore (SIN) → New York (JFK) | Singapore Airlines | ~15,349 km | ~18 hr 10 min | Airbus A350-900ULR |
This flight first began in 2020 and has held its crown ever since - flying nearly 19 hours straight across continents and oceans.

Record Update: New Longest Non-Stop Flight?

In late 2025, a new record-breaker emerged in the nonstop category:
Xiamen Air’s New York (JFK) → Fuzhou (FOC) flight, clocking up to 19 hours and 20 minutes in the air.
This flight pushes past the Singapore Airlines record in duration – mostly because it avoids flying over Russia, which makes the route take longer in time, even if the distance isn’t greater.
So yes – as of late 2025, there are two ways to define “longest”:
- By distance: Singapore ↔ New York (still #1)
- By flight time: Xiamen Air’s JFK ↔ Fuzhou route
Why Ultra-Long-Haul Flights Are Possible
So how do airlines even manage to fly for nearly a full day without stopping?
- Modern Wide-Body Aircraft – Planes like the Airbus A350-900ULR and Boeing 787-9 are engineered for efficiency with lighter materials, larger fuel capacity, and super-efficient engines.
- Fuel Efficiency Improvements – Better aerodynamics and fuel burn rates make it possible to fly farther than ever before.
- Improved Passenger Comfort – From low cabin pressure to advanced lighting, flying long distances is more bearable today.
- Strategic Flight Routing – Jets take the most fuel-efficient paths, even if that means circumnavigating airspaces that might add time.
Top 10 Longest Non-Stop Flights in the World
| Rank | Route (Origin → Destination) | Airline | Approx Distance | Approx Duration | Aircraft |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| New York (JFK) → Fuzhou (FOC) | Xiamen Air | ~7,077 mi | ~19h 20m | Boeing 787-9 |
| 2 | New York (JFK) → Singapore (SIN) | Singapore Airlines | ~9,537 mi | ~18h 50m | Airbus A350-900ULR |
| 3 | Newark (EWR) → Singapore (SIN) | Singapore Airlines | ~9,539 mi | ~18h 30m | Airbus A350-900ULR |
| 4 | Doha (DOH) → Auckland (AKL) | Qatar Airways | ~9,041 mi | ~17h 35m | Airbus A350-1000 |
| 5 | Perth (PER) → London (LHR) | Qantas | ~9,009 mi | ~17h 20m | Boeing 787 |
| 6 | Melbourne (MEL) → Dallas (DFW) | Qantas | ~8,992 mi | ~17h 35m | Boeing 787 |
| 7 | Auckland (AKL) → New York (JFK) | Air New Zealand | ~8,828 mi | ~17h 50m | Boeing 787 |
| 8 | Dubai (DXB) → Auckland (AKL) | Emirates | ~8,824 mi | ~17h 10m | Airbus A380 |
| 9 | Singapore (SIN) → Los Angeles (LAX) | Singapore Airlines | ~8,770 mi | ~17h 50m | Airbus A350 |
| 10 | Bengaluru (BLR) → San Francisco (SFO) | Air India | ~8,701 mi | ~17h 40m | Boeing 777-200LR |
There’s sometimes a difference between "top by distance" and "top by duration" — because flight times also depend on winds, weather conditions, and airspace restrictions.
New Longest Flight Records & Special Cases
Longest Scheduled Direct Route
A new ultra-long route from Shanghai → Buenos Aires launched in late 2025 covering roughly 20,000 km (~12,427 miles) and lasting over a full day of travel, but it includes a fuel stop in Auckland, New Zealand that does not require passengers to deplane. Because this is not technically non-stop, it’s called the longest direct flight route, not a non-stop.
This means aviation now has two kinds of “longest” flights:
- Longest non-stop (no stops at all)
- Longest direct but with a stop where passengers stay onboard
Flight Duration vs. Distance — What’s the Difference?

When we say “longest flight,” people often assume it means the longest distance flown. But in aviation, there are two important measures:
Distance
- Measured in miles or kilometers – how far between airport A & B on a map.
- Usually based on great-circle distance (the shortest path over Earth’s surface).
Duration
- Time from when the aircraft pushes back from the gate in the origin until it reaches the gate at the destination.
- Influenced by winds, speed, routing, air traffic control, and sometimes weather.
So a flight with a slightly shorter distance might still take longer time due to routing choices — which is why New York → Fuzhou can have a higher duration record even if the distance is shorter than New York → Singapore.

Travel Tips for Ultra-Long Haul Flights
Before Flight
- Choose a good seat early (bulkhead or aisle if you plan to move around)
- Apply moisturizer and stay hydrated (cabin air is dry!)
- Wear comfortable layers and compression socks
During the Flight
- Walk around every few hours
- Do light stretching in your seat
- Load up entertainment (movies, podcasts, music playlists)
Sleep Tips
- Use a neck pillow
- Bring eye mask and earplugs
- Avoid alcohol (it dehydrates)
